I don’t have penis envy, but watching The Bachelor makes me want to change teams. Watching the way these women behave makes me embarrassed to be part of their club. When asked how he approached his experience on The Bachelorette, the current bachelor Jason said that he wanted to have as much fun as he could. That is the difference between how men and women approach this show. These girls are not here for a good time – they are on a mission.
The dental hygienist Shannon, who may have brought her own supply of nitrous oxide along, is actually hard-core. She may giggle incessantly and shower Jason with compliments usually reserved for a kitten, but she means business. She has done her stalking, I mean research. Jason may find this flattering, but I find it and her disturbing on a lot of levels.
This whole deal has gotten way too competitive. I understand that the premise of the show is to win the bachelor’s heart, but seriously. These gals all act as if they need to place themselves in Jason’s direct line of vision at all times or they won’t get a rose. That doesn’t say much for any impression they may have made. The minute he is out of site with another woman, they all freak out. The benign sounding “can I steal him for a minute?” sounds like the girls just want to tell Jason his fly is down or that he has a phone call, when in fact they are rudely interrupting a conversation. They should just say what they mean: “My turn.” It was refreshing to see that Stephanie had the good manners and sense to back off when she was encouraged to interrupt.
There was an episode of The Bachelorette when DeAnna had a meltdown because all the guys were horsing around and not paying enough attention to her. That would never happen on The Bachelor. Those guys seemed to be having a good time while trying to impress her. These women, with a couple of exceptions, are just trying to impress Jason. The ones who are having a bit of fun are the ones that should impress him. Those are the ones that I’ll be rooting for.
